Trends in Food and Beverage to Watch
Practical Foods and Gut Health Go Mainstream
Current food and beverage trends are now placing gut health in the forefront. When shopping the grocery aisles, expect to see more prebiotic sodas, fermented snacks, and probiotic-rich foods on shelves as consumers are prioritizing mood-boosting and immunity-enhancing options that support a holistic, or wellness lifestyle.
Plant-Based Gets A Revamp
New food trends are redefining what it really means to eat plant-based. Be on the lookout for innovative proteins made from mushrooms, seaweed, and repurposed ingredients. Plant-based seafood is also getting an upgrade offering sustainable alternatives with a gourmet appeal.
Deluxe Packaged Goods
Brands are joining in on the trends in food and beverage by investing in aesthetically pleasing designs to their nutritious offerings. Think beautifully packaged snacks, drinks and pantry staples that are Instagram worthy as well as nourishing highlighting clean ingredients and bold and exciting flavors.
Low-ABV and Botanical Beverages Are On The Rise
In recent years, beverage trends are shifting into moderation and mindfulness. Consumers are stocking up on low-alcohol spritzes, botanical cocktails, and adaptogenic drinks adding them to their at home bar-carts as healthy home entertaining options.
Global Fusion Flavors Are Popping Up On Menus
While more consumers are travelling globally, their taste buds have evolved. Chefs are blending spices, techniques and traditions that include cross-cultural mashups to excite the palate.
